Live Comments
15:30 - Thanks for joining me for this, the 10th stage of the Giro. In the overall classifications, Visconti maintains his lead, with Kloden in sixth.
14:59 -
Alberto Contador JUST misses out on Brusegin's time and BRUSEGIN IS GOING TO WIN THE STAGE!!!!
15:42 - Pre-race favourite, Andreas Klöden is going well so far. He could have a chance to break the time here.
15:37 -
Marzio Bruseghin DESTROYS Pinotti's time, coming in with 56:41!!!! The former Italian national time trial champion gave it everything there.
15:33 - Dennis Menchov comes in with 57:27 to slide into second place.
15.21 -
MARCO PINOTTI, of the high road team, has blasted away the field to take the lead with a time of 57:17. That will take SOME CATCHING!
14:40 - Vasil Kiryineka (Tinkoff) finishes 10 seconds behind Tony Martin.
